Abstract: The hydrodynamics of cavitation flows were simulated by varying different parameters (pressure, speed, temperature) with the improvement of the static cavitation emulsifier design to reduce the cavitation number. Subsequently, the dependencies of the cavitation number on fluid velocity, temperature, and Reynolds number were constructed.
